+"""Download a file from CIPD.
+
+This is used for downloading a tool executable managed in CIPD.
+
+CIPD URI format is locally defined for this script.
+Example:
+cipd://chromiumos/infra/tclint/linux-amd64:${version}
+chromiumos/infra/tclint/linux-amd64 is the path sent to cipd tool,
+and ${version} is the version defined in CIPD.
+"""

+def ParseCipdUri(uri):
+  o = urllib.parse.urlparse(uri)
+  if o.scheme != 'cipd':
+    raise ValueError('wrong scheme: ', o.scheme)
+  if ':' not in o.path:
+    raise ValueError('version not specified')
+  pkgpath, version = o.path.rsplit(':', 1)
+  return (o.netloc + pkgpath, version)
